Video camera men are often referred to by various names depending on their role and the industry they work in. Let’s dive into some of the commonly used terms.
1. Cameraman or Camera Operator
One of the most common terms used for a video camera man is ‘Cameraman’ or ‘Camera Operator’.
This term is prevalent in the film and television industry, where they are responsible for operating a camera during filming. They work closely with the director of photography and help capture the desired shots.
2. Cinematographer
‘Cinematographer’ is another term used in the film industry for a video camera man. This term is often used for those who specialize in creative and artistic aspects of filming, including lighting, framing, and composition.
3. Videographer
The term ‘Videographer’ is commonly used in events such as weddings, corporate events, and other live events that require filming. They are responsible for capturing footage of events as they unfold and creating a final video product that tells a story.
4. Director of Photography
A ‘Director of Photography’ is responsible for overseeing all visual aspects of filming, including lighting, framing, and camera movement. They work closely with the director to ensure that their vision for the project is realized on screen.
5. DOP or DP
‘DOP’ or ‘DP’ is an acronym widely used in the film industry to refer to a Director of Photography.
